vCenter 6.5 manage esxi 6.7

My vCenter Server Appliance is at version 6.5.0.23000 (Build 10964411) and I just updated one of the host in the cluster to ESXi version 6.7.0 (Build 8169922).  When trying to reconnect the host to the cluster I get an error message.

A general system error occurred:  Timed out waiting for vpxa to start.

Any ideas what I need to do to get my host connected to vCenter?

Hello,

vCenter server 6.5 doesn't manage ESXi 6.7.

With your case, go and update your vCenter to 6.7 because there is no way to downgrade the host unless your data are outside (Storage) and you can format and install the old ESXi.
